The article presents the results of a study of the properties of concrete, which can be used for the construction of hydraulic structures, the preliminary composition of which was determined using the ACI 211.4R-2008 standard. The effect of using the developed complex organo-mineral modifying additive consisting of thermal power plant fly ash, microsilicon SF-90 (MK90), methakaolin and polycarboxylate superplasticizer SR 5000F (SP) on changing the properties of hydraulic concrete was also studied.
